Dr Samit Kumar Nandi completed B. V. Sc. & A. H. and M. V. Sc in 1991 and 1993 from Bidhan Chandra Krishi Vishwavidyalaya, respectively, and Ph. D. in 2006 from West Bengal University of Animal & Fishery Sciences. Prof. Nandi joined the University in 2000 as a Lecturer in the Department of Veterinary Surgery and Radiology at this university. He served as Head of the Department from 2011-13 and 2018- 2020.

Prof. Nandi has made a significant contribution to the field of biomedical research using orthopaedic, soft tissue, cartilage tissue, and vascular tissue biomaterials with special reference to the utilization of biological wastes in collaboration with premier Indian research Institutes like CSIR-Central Glass and Ceramic Research Institute, Kolkata, Indian Institute of Technology, Guwahati, Kharagpur, Roorkee, Indian Institute of Science, Education, and Research, Kolkata, R. G. Kar Medical College and Hospital, Jadavpur University, NIT, Rourkela, Manipal University, Jaipur, etc. His research has a tremendous scope in using such biomaterials for animal and human surgical problems.

He has completed 18 research projects funded by ICAR, DBT, SERB, ANRF, Government of India, and is presently running four projects funded by the Department of Science & Technology, Government of India. Prof. Nandi received a Travel Grant award from Indo-US Science and Technology Forum, New Delhi, to work as Adjunct Faculty in 2012 at the School of Mechanical and Materials Engineering, Washington State University, USA. He has supervised/supervised over 18 Master’s and 12 PhD students in Veterinary Surgery and Radiology and allied subjects. His students have moved to academia and labs within and outside India. He is a prolific writer and has contributed more than 69 scientific papers to National and 150 International journals of repute, 3 books, 30 International book chapters, granted 5 Patents, and applied for another 9 National patents, and has citations of 6913 with an h-index of 45. He published a few papers with the Department of Bioengineering, University of Pittsburgh, Department of Biomedical Engineering, Tufts University, Medford, Massachusetts, and School of Mechanical and Materials Engineering, Washington State University, United States.
